- This golf spikes kit is suitable for sneakers with flat rubber soles and a minimum thickness of 1/3 inch, ensuring a secure and effective fit. The self-tapping golf spikes provide excellent grip on the golf course and stable, green-friendly traction.
-
The GENERAL RULE is flat rubber (not foam) soles. So Basketball, tennis/court shoes tend to have flat soles and good structure for comfort.
- Skate shoes look cool but tend to have thin soles.
- Running shoes/hokas can be hard to find FLAT spots for the cleats you need a flat spot about the size of a nickel to mount a single Golfkicks cleat.
- The more comfy a shoe is before the spikes go in the more comfortable they’ll be on the golf course. For example if you screw them into Vans, Dunks, Chuck Taylors they have a very thin sole and you might not want to walk 18 holes in them.
We have seen it all - cowboy boots, sandals, adding to existing spike-less golf shoes but some of these require ADVANCED installs so it depends on the customer and their confidence in doing this.

Shoe Guidance
- Soles need to be 1/3 inch thick and have FLAT RUBBER (NOT FOAM) on the bottom.
- Mount Golfkicks on a FLAT area of your shoe so that the disc part of the cleat has FULL CONTACT with your sole for support. Do not hang off raised traction. Do not install a cleat way up on your toe this is not necessary.
- ALL SHOES ARE DIFFERENT, the thinner the sole the more you will feel traction underfoot.
- If you have a lot of traction on the sole you don't need Golfkicks.
